Note: For trees purchased as "bare-root" plants, it is essential to keep the roots moist. They should be stored in a "growing medium"—a mixture of sand and moist potting soil—until they are planted.

1) Soil Aeration

It is recommended to loosen the soil in the area where the tree will be planted to a depth of about 60 cm as soon as the first autumn rains arrive. This will help the tree take root once planted.
You can use a broadfork or a spading fork.

Amending the soil with compost and wood chips

However, the most important step is to cover the soil before planting with a good layer of compost and/or wood chips (a product made from shredded branches).
Covering the loosened soil before planting can be done simply by spreading branches and various types of yard waste over it.

2) Size of the planting hole

  • - Using the appropriate tools (pickaxe, spade, shovel), dig a hole approximately 50–60

    cm in diameter and H: 50–60 cm deep (see diagram below).

  • - It is also important to respect the order of the different soil layers during planting: do not mix the different soil horizons; replace the topsoil, which was set aside earlier, last during planting.

    3) Pralinage:

 

 

For bare-root trees, to stimulate root growth and protect the roots, dip the roots in a mixture called “Pralin” (clay, water, and potting soil/compost, or clay, water, and cow manure).

This mixture should be prepared in large containers, such as trash cans. Potted trees do not need this.
